Moliqaj reminds Kurt of statements about the current: When you change your beliefs, you normally change your promises

Dardan Molliqaj of PSD has reminded Prime Minister Albin Kurti of his 2019 resolution in campaign time, writes Periscope. On September 26th, 2019, Kosovo's current prime minister, Albin Kurti, had said the electricity price would be lowered, though he could not provide accurate answers to how low he would be. He also said they would not pay with Kosovo's budget the current for those who pay, alluding to citizens in northern Kosovo.

Moliqaj through a Facebook post has reminded Kurt of Kurt's promises about electricity.

Among other things, he says that he could not conclude otherwise.

When you change your beliefs, you normally change your promises”, Molly's done./Periscope. com/

Full Posting:

He promised to cut the electricity prices, now he's raising them.

He promised that he would not pay the electricity to the northern Serbs, he is now paying it.

It promised revision of the KEK's privatisation process of distribution, now on our taxes it is paying 120m euros in losses to KEDS.

He promised criminal prosecution for privatisation privatists of the distribution, but made Mimoza Kusarin chief of the party's parliamentary group.

When he promised to cut the prices, he really believed that the prices were high. Like when you raise the prices you believe they are low.

There was no way to end otherwise. When you change your beliefs, you normally change your promises.
